KIA’s EV plans
The EV-6 to be first electric car from KIA to launch in India. The manufacturer announced that they will launch7 electric vehicles in India by 2027. Recently, they also announced a small affordable electric vehicle which could be the electric version of the Sonet compact SUV which we reported about. This is because the Sonet is currently the most affordable vehicle that KIA offers in our country, also KIA understands that a product like the EV-6 would never become amass product due to its high cost . It would only be a variant that would attract attention to bring people to the more affordable compact SUV EV’S KIA might bring in the market.
e-GMP platform
The EV-6 is based on the e-GMP platform which stands for Electric Modular Global platform, the platform in its most basic form resembles a skateboard where the wheels are in all the four farther corners and the middle floor is used to store batteries which provides the car with low centre of gravity as well. And since there is no transmission tunnel because the car has been developed as an EV passengers get more space in the cabin

International Variants
The international market version of the EV6 is sold as an all-wheel drive and rear-wheel drive powertrain. There are two battery packs on offer, a 58 kWh one and a 77.4 kWh one. The rear-wheel drive 58 kWh battery pack has a WLTP-rated driving range of 400 km. The all-wheel drive 77.4 kWh battery pack has a driving range of around 510 km.
